Abstract—This research provides a method for analyzing the
performance of a rectangular microstrip structure by adopting
Cole-Cole diagram. A “reactive relaxation” concept is
introduced to represent the frequency-dependent
characteristics of a microstrip. Included in the algorithm are
relevant considerations relevant to the substrate dielectric and
strip-line conductor losses. The proposed concept is used to
analyze the microstrip structure performance. The proposed
models are set up for use in computer-aided microstrip design
and are fully compatible with the needs and trends of modern
computer-aided microstrip antenna design and RF integrated
circuit (RFID) design.
Index Terms—Dielectric substrate, cole-cole diagram,
frequency-dependent, microstrip structure.
